A press forming method of forming a press-formed product including: a web portion; a side wall portion continuous from the web portion; a flange portion continuous from the side wall portion; and a concave curved portion in which the web portion and/or the flange portion is concavely curved in a height direction along a longitudinal direction in side view, the press forming method comprising:
a first forming process of press-forming a blank into a preformed part in which a portion corresponding to the web portion and a portion corresponding to the side wall portion including a twisted side wall portion of a twisted shape along the longitudinal direction are formed, the preformed part including a portion corresponding to the concave curved portion; and
a second forming process of press-forming the preformed part into the press-formed product,
wherein the twisted side wall portion at the first forming process is twisted such that an angle between the twisted side wall portion and the portion corresponding to the web portion is smaller on an end portion side than at a longitudinal center of the portion corresponding to the concave curved portion, and
wherein the twisted side wall portion of the preformed part has a torsion amount T given by a following equation, the torsion amount T being set to be in a range of 10° or larger and 20° or smaller:
T=Δθ×(H/L),
where
Δθ: an angle difference (=θ1−θ2),
θ1: an angle (°) between the twisted side wall portion and the portion corresponding to the web portion at the longitudinal center of the portion corresponding to the concave curved portion,
θ2: an angle (°) between the twisted side wall portion and the portion corresponding to the web portion at a longitudinal end portion of the twisted side wall portion,
H: a side wall height (mm) of the twisted side wall portion, and
L: a longitudinal length (mm) of the twisted side wall portion.
